|
|
|
@ -12,24 +12,16 @@ import ( |
|
|
|
|
"time" |
|
|
|
|
|
|
|
|
|
"github.com/facebookgo/inject" |
|
|
|
|
"github.com/grafana/grafana/pkg/api" |
|
|
|
|
"github.com/grafana/grafana/pkg/api/routing" |
|
|
|
|
"github.com/grafana/grafana/pkg/bus" |
|
|
|
|
"github.com/grafana/grafana/pkg/middleware" |
|
|
|
|
"github.com/grafana/grafana/pkg/registry" |
|
|
|
|
|
|
|
|
|
"golang.org/x/sync/errgroup" |
|
|
|
|
|
|
|
|
|
"github.com/grafana/grafana/pkg/api"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/extensions" |
|
|
|
|
"github.com/grafana/grafana/pkg/log" |
|
|
|
|
"github.com/grafana/grafana/pkg/login" |
|
|
|
|
"github.com/grafana/grafana/pkg/setting" |
|
|
|
|
|
|
|
|
|
"github.com/grafana/grafana/pkg/social" |
|
|
|
|
|
|
|
|
|
// self registering services
|
|
|
|
|
_ "github.com/grafana/grafana/pkg/extensions"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/metrics" |
|
|
|
|
"github.com/grafana/grafana/pkg/middleware"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/plugins" |
|
|
|
|
"github.com/grafana/grafana/pkg/registry"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/services/alerting"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/services/cleanup"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/services/notifications" |
|
|
|
@ -37,7 +29,10 @@ import ( |
|
|
|
|
_ "github.com/grafana/grafana/pkg/services/rendering"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/services/search" |
|
|
|
|
_ "github.com/grafana/grafana/pkg/services/sqlstore" |
|
|
|
|
"github.com/grafana/grafana/pkg/setting" |
|
|
|
|
"github.com/grafana/grafana/pkg/social" // self registering services
|
|
|
|
|
_ "github.com/grafana/grafana/pkg/tracing" |
|
|
|
|
"golang.org/x/sync/errgroup" |
|
|
|
|
) |
|
|
|
|
|
|
|
|
|
func NewGrafanaServer() *GrafanaServerImpl { |
|
|
|
@ -159,7 +154,7 @@ func (g *GrafanaServerImpl) loadConfiguration() { |
|
|
|
|
os.Exit(1) |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|
g.log.Info("Starting "+setting.ApplicationName, "version", version, "commit", commit, "compiled", time.Unix(setting.BuildStamp, 0)) |
|
|
|
|
g.log.Info("Starting "+setting.ApplicationName, "version", version, "commit", commit, "branch", buildBranch, "compiled", time.Unix(setting.BuildStamp, 0)) |
|
|
|
|
g.cfg.LogConfigSources() |
|
|
|
|
} |
|
|
|
|
|
|
|
|
|